# Customer Churn Prediction
One of the most critical applications of predictive analytics is in reducing customer churn. By analyzing customer data, businesses can predict which customers are likely to leave and take proactive measures to retain them. For instance, a telecom company might use predictive analytics to identify customers who are at risk of switching to another provider. The course will teach you how to build a predictive model using customer demographics, usage patterns, and service interactions to forecast churn. This knowledge can help you develop targeted retention strategies, significantly boosting customer satisfaction and loyalty.
# Sales Forecasting
Accurate sales forecasting is crucial for inventory management, budgeting, and resource allocation. A retail chain, for example, could use historical sales data and external factors like weather or holidays to predict future sales. The course will guide you through the process of creating a sales forecasting model, incorporating multiple variables to improve accuracy. This can lead to better inventory management, reduced waste, and improved financial planning.
# Fraud Detection
In the financial sector, predictive analytics is key to detecting and preventing fraud. Banks and credit card companies use advanced algorithms to identify unusual patterns that may indicate fraudulent activity. The course will cover the use of machine learning techniques like anomaly detection and clustering to identify potential fraud cases. By understanding these methods, you can help your organization safeguard against financial losses and maintain customer trust.
# Supply Chain Optimization
Optimizing supply chain operations is another vital application of predictive analytics. By analyzing past supply chain data, businesses can predict demand, optimize inventory levels, and streamline logistics. A logistics company might use predictive analytics to forecast shipping delays and adjust delivery schedules accordingly. The course will teach you how to build predictive models for supply chain planning, ensuring that your organization can meet customer demands efficiently and cost-effectively.
